The thing I love the most about Ramadan:
the fantastic settings in 
Cairo’s streets from lanterns, colored lights, free food outdoor tables 
(ma’’det el-rahman) and the cozy culture from meeting friends after 
breaking the fast (Iftar) or big family gatherings.

The hardest/most annoying thing about Ramadan : 
the wrong per-
ception of people about Ramadan, that it’s just for upkeeping yourself 
from eating and drinking, and not understanding the true meaning of 
it, from self-disciplinary and training your will, to sharing the moments 
of other poor people all over the world. The second most annoying 
thing is, people giving an excuse of fasting to behave stupidly/weirdly. 
What I want to get out of Ramadan this year : 
I would like to talk 
to more people to make them aware of the ‘true’ spirit of Ramadan, or 
at least how I see it, and for me to question the religion which will lead 
me either to strengthen my beliefs or change it.

Chanting
A member of the International Society for Krishna Consciousness 
described the effect of chanting 
Hare Krishna
, the name of the Lord.
I had already found the philosophy brilliant but it was the 
kirtan 
that 
really convinced me. I saw how the devotees would chant on the street 
for five hours and then, at one festival I attended, when everyone was 
lying down in a tent waiting for food, tired after being on the street all 
those hours, a spontaneous kirtan began and lasted for more than 
another hour. There was no one around to see. It was just an expres-
sion of the devotees’ love for God. This personal expression of feeling 
for God was the best I’d ever experienced. Everything else was forgot-
ten. Only the name of the One we loved or aspired to love was repeated, 
over and over, creating a wonderful connection with God. Chanting 
alone can lead us to love of God.

Yoga
Widely popular in the West nowadays, yoga is practised in various ways. 
Some schools of yoga are more, some less closely based on the original 
teachings in the Upanishads, where Shiva is seen as the god of 
yogins
or 
ascetics. A classic work is 
The Yoga Aphorisms of Patanjali
in which yoga 
is explained as ‘union’, or ‘yoke’, a method leading to union with ultimate 
reality through control of thought-waves of the mind. Commentators 
have used the image of a lake. When the surface is disturbed, full of waves, 
the bottom, the atman or soul, cannot be seen. The aim is the one-pointed 
mind, resulting in clarity and stillness.

Yoga does not merely involve exercise, as is so often the case in 
Western classes, but is a holistic system including disciplined conduct and 
meditation as well as breathing techniques.
Here is an account of the effect of yoga.
Over the past fifteen years some of the most exciting openings 
have come to me through the practice of yoga and the study of yoga 
philosophy. Through the practice of the physical postures of yoga I not 
only made my body supple and balanced, but found a way of bringing 
my awareness into the present moment, so that without any great 
effort I could touch the experience of life in the NOW. Through the 
practice of concentration and meditation I began to take charge of my 
mind so that I could at times prevent my mental energy from diffusing 
in all directions and could conserve my inner power, or direct it like a 
beam in the direction of my choice. Through Yoga Nidra I learned 
a technique in which my body, mind and emotions experience 
complete relaxation, while my consciousness, fully aware, touched the 
deep dimensions of power within me. Through chanting a mantra 
I can still the mind, or use the sound like a booster rocket to take my 
consciousness to higher dimensions of my being. By practising breath 
control I have discovered ways of linking body, mind and soul, touch-
ing the deep levels of peace within me.
